玉林冬季免耕马铃薯分期播种试验及优质高产气候分析

摘    要:对玉林市主栽的马铃薯品种黑龙江K 3紫花,采用稻草免耕、地膜覆盖和常耕栽培三种栽培措施分五次播种进行试验,表明,稻草免耕技术不但对地面温度、土壤湿度有很好调节功能,而且与地膜覆盖和常耕栽培产量差异达极显著水平。以播期为11月30日的产量最高,播期为12月10日产量最低。

Study on Climatic Bases Increasing Potato Yield for No-tillage Cultivation with Straw Covering and Optimum Sowing Date in Winter of Yuling City

Abstract:The experiment was conducted for cultivation measure of no-tillage cultivation with straw covering,plastic covering and conventional cultivation for the main cultivars HeiLongJiangk3ZhiHua and different sowing date of five times in YuLing.The result was showed that no-tillage cultivation not only had better regulation function of temperature of ground and soil humidity,but also had a significant difference for conventional in the aspect of yield,the sowing date of 11.30 had a highest yield,on the contrary the date of 12.30 was worst.
